在数字化时代,数据完整性如同一座坚固的堡垒,保护着视频采集卡中的信息不被篡改或丢失。本文将深入探讨数据完整性的概念及其在视频采集卡中的重要性,同时揭示如何通过技术手段确保数据的准确性和可靠性。让我们一起揭开数据完整性的神秘面纱,探索其在视频采集卡中的应用与价值。
# 一、数据完整性的定义与重要性
数据完整性是指数据在存储、传输和处理过程中保持其原始状态和准确性。它确保数据在任何阶段都未被意外修改或损坏。在视频采集卡中,数据完整性尤为重要,因为视频数据通常包含大量信息,任何细微的错误都可能导致图像质量下降或数据丢失。
视频采集卡是连接摄像头和计算机的重要设备,负责将模拟视频信号转换为数字信号。在这个过程中,数据完整性至关重要。如果数据完整性受损,可能会导致图像模糊、色彩失真或帧率降低等问题。这些问题不仅影响视频质量,还可能对后续的视频编辑和分析工作造成严重影响。
# 二、视频采集卡中的数据完整性挑战
视频采集卡在处理大量数据时面临诸多挑战。首先,数据传输速度非常快,每秒可能需要处理数百万个像素点。其次,视频信号本身具有复杂性和动态性,需要高度精确的处理。此外,硬件故障、电磁干扰和软件错误也可能导致数据完整性受损。
为了应对这些挑战,视频采集卡通常采用多种技术手段来确保数据完整性。例如,使用校验码(如CRC校验)来检测和纠正错误;采用冗余设计来备份关键数据;以及利用硬件和软件的双重保护机制来防止数据丢失或损坏。
# 三、确保数据完整性的技术手段
1. 校验码技术:校验码是一种常见的数据完整性检查方法。通过在数据中添加额外的校验信息,可以在传输过程中检测到错误并进行纠正。例如,循环冗余校验(CRC)是一种常用的校验码技术,能够有效检测出数据传输中的错误。
2. 冗余设计:冗余设计是指在系统中设置多个备份或副本,以确保即使某个部分出现故障,整个系统仍能正常运行。在视频采集卡中,可以通过存储多个副本或使用镜像存储来实现冗余设计,从而提高数据的可靠性和稳定性。
3. 硬件和软件双重保护:硬件和软件的双重保护机制可以有效防止数据完整性受损。硬件层面可以通过使用高质量的元器件和严格的制造工艺来减少故障率;软件层面则可以通过编写健壮的代码和进行定期的系统维护来确保系统的稳定运行。
# 四、实际应用案例
为了更好地理解数据完整性在视频采集卡中的应用,我们可以通过一个实际案例来说明。假设一家电视台正在使用视频采集卡来录制新闻节目。为了确保录制的视频质量,他们采用了多种技术手段来确保数据完整性。
首先,他们使用了先进的校验码技术,通过在每个视频帧中添加CRC校验码来检测和纠正错误。其次,他们采用了冗余设计,在存储设备中设置了多个副本,以防止因硬件故障导致的数据丢失。最后,他们还加强了软件层面的保护措施,定期进行系统维护和代码优化,确保系统的稳定运行。
通过这些措施,电视台成功地确保了录制视频的数据完整性,即使在极端条件下也能保持高质量的图像和声音。
# 五、未来展望
随着技术的不断进步,视频采集卡的数据完整性保护也将迎来新的挑战和机遇。未来,我们可以期待更先进的校验码技术、更高效的冗余设计以及更智能的软件保护机制。这些技术将共同推动视频采集卡的发展,使其在更广泛的领域中发挥更大的作用。
总之,数据完整性是视频采集卡中不可或缺的重要组成部分。通过采用多种技术手段,我们可以确保视频数据在存储、传输和处理过程中保持其原始状态和准确性。未来,随着技术的不断进步,我们有理由相信视频采集卡的数据完整性保护将更加完善,为用户提供更加可靠和高质量的视频体验。
---
通过这篇文章,我们不仅了解了数据完整性的概念及其在视频采集卡中的重要性,还探讨了如何通过技术手段确保数据的准确性和可靠性。希望这篇文章能够帮助读者更好地理解这一关键概念,并为相关领域的研究和应用提供参考。